    I've looked around the posts and have found neither a description, nor a picture of what has decided to show up in one of my last bottles. Most of the descriptions I've seen are describing either yeast that has not settled, or some shiny floaters that it sounds like they are yeast as well.

    If you put those images aside, what I have here is sort of like a chunky cobweb that is suspended in the bottom third of the bottle. It might be alive....it moves a little when I turn the bottle. All of the other bottles I've consumed from this batch were fine.

    So do I have a possible infection, or should I notify NASA of a new life form? I'd post a picture, but don't know how to do that from the "HB Talk" app I just started using. Thanks for any thoughts!
